Here are some ideas for reusing and recycling old wooden boxes into useful objects for your house and garden:
Shelving Unit: Stack the wooden boxes horizontally and vertically to create a unique shelving unit. You can use it to display books, plants, or other decorative items.
Coffee Table: Place a large wooden box with a sturdy lid on top of four smaller boxes as legs to create a rustic coffee table. You can also paint or stain it to match your interior decor.
Herb Garden: Convert wooden boxes into planters for growing herbs. Line the inside with plastic, fill them with soil, and plant your favorite herbs. Arrange the boxes in your garden or hang them on a wall for a vertical herb garden.
Storage Organizer: Attach multiple wooden boxes together vertically or horizontally to create a storage organizer for your garage or shed. It’s perfect for storing tools, gardening supplies, or small items.
Wall-mounted Bookshelf: Mount a wooden box on the wall horizontally to serve as a floating bookshelf. Arrange the boxes at different heights and angles to create an interesting display.
Pet Bed: Remove one side of a wooden box and add a soft cushion to create a cozy bed for your furry friend. Paint or stain the box to match your decor.
Planter Box: Convert wooden boxes into planter boxes for your garden or balcony. Line the inside with plastic, add soil, and plant flowers, vegetables, or succulents. You can even stack them vertically to create a cascading effect.
Storage Ottoman: Attach four legs to a wooden box and add a padded cushion to the top to create a stylish storage ottoman. It can serve as extra seating and provide storage space for blankets or other items.
Wall-mounted Organizer: Mount wooden boxes on a wall to create a versatile organizer for keys, mail, and other small items. Add hooks or labels to each box for easy organization.
Birdhouse: Transform a wooden box into a charming birdhouse. Cut a small entrance hole in one side, add a perch, and paint it in vibrant colors. Hang it in your garden to attract birds.
Remember, when reusing and recycling wooden boxes, it’s important to clean them thoroughly, remove any nails or splinters, and consider treating them with a suitable sealant or paint to protect them from weathering or pests.
